Exercices Python Basic

Exercice 3 Python Corrigé

Ecrire un programme qui permet de calculer le montant des heures supplémentaires d’un employé, sachant le prix unitaire d’une heure selon le barème suivant :

  • Les 39 premières heures sans supplément,
  • De la 40ième à la 44ième heure sont majorées de 50%,
  • De la 45ième à la 49ième heure sont majorées de 75%,
  • De la 50ième heure ou plus, sont majorées de 100%.
nbheures = int ( input (" saisir ␣le␣ nombre ␣d␣ heures "))
prix = float ( input (" saisir ␣le␣ prix ␣ unitaire ␣d␣ une ␣ heure ")) montant =0
if nbheures <=39 : montant =0
elif nbheures <45 :
montant =( nbheures - 39)*( prix *1.5) elif nbheures <50 :
montant =(5* prix * 1. 5) +( nbheures - 44)*( prix * 1. 75)
else :
montant =(5* prix * 1 . 5 ) +( 5 * prix * 1. 75) +( nbheures - 49)*( prix *2) print (" le␣ montant ␣ des ␣ heures ␣ supplementaires ␣ est ␣: ␣", montant )

 

Ajouter un commentaire

Veuillez vous connecter pour ajouter un commentaire.

Pas encore de commentaires.